wordpress建站教程入门,网站后台有哪些模块,网站项目开发,可以做动漫的网站有哪些第一章#xff1a;Open-AutoGLM电商报名自动化的革命性意义 在电商平台日益激烈的竞争环境中#xff0c;活动报名的效率与准确性直接决定商家的曝光机会和转化潜力。传统的人工报名方式不仅耗时耗力#xff0c;还容易因操作失误导致资格失效。Open-AutoGLM 的出现彻底改变了…第一章Open-AutoGLM电商报名自动化的革命性意义在电商平台日益激烈的竞争环境中活动报名的效率与准确性直接决定商家的曝光机会和转化潜力。传统的人工报名方式不仅耗时耗力还容易因操作失误导致资格失效。Open-AutoGLM 的出现彻底改变了这一局面它基于先进的自然语言理解与自动化决策能力实现了电商活动从识别、填报到提交的全流程智能化。智能解析与自适应填报Open-AutoGLM 能够实时抓取平台发布的活动规则并通过语义分析提取关键条件如报名时间、库存要求、价格限制等。系统自动匹配符合条件的商品并完成表单填写大幅降低人工干预。自动登录电商平台管理后台解析活动页面中的结构化与非结构化数据调用内部商品数据库进行精准匹配生成合规报名参数并模拟提交流程高效稳定的执行代码示例以下是一个简化版的自动化任务调度逻辑使用 Python 实现核心控制流# 自动化报名主流程 def auto_apply_campaign(): # 初始化浏览器会话 driver webdriver.Chrome() login_e_shop(driver) # 登录函数 # 获取活动列表并解析规则 campaigns fetch_campaign_list(driver) for campaign in campaigns: if evaluate_eligibility(campaign): # 判断是否符合报名条件 fill_form_and_submit(driver, campaign) # 填写并提交 log_success(campaign[id]) # 记录成功日志 # 执行任务 if __name__ __main__: schedule.every().day.at(08:00).do(auto_apply_campaign) while True: schedule.run_pending() time.sleep(60)性能提升对比指标人工操作Open-AutoGLM单次报名耗时5-10分钟30秒错误率约15%1%并发处理能力1人1账号单实例支持50账号graph TD A[检测新活动发布] -- B{规则可解析?} B --|是| C[提取报名条件] B --|否| D[标记人工审核] C -- E[匹配可用商品] E -- F[自动生成申请] F -- G[提交并记录结果]第二章核心模块一至五的理论构建与实践验证2.1 活动规则智能解析引擎的设计原理与落地实现活动规则智能解析引擎旨在将非结构化的运营配置转化为可执行的逻辑判断单元。其核心采用基于抽象语法树AST的解析机制将规则表达式编译为中间表示便于后续调度与优化。规则解析流程输入规则DSL文本如“用户等级≥3且近7天登录次数5”词法分析提取关键字、操作符与数值语法分析构建AST形成条件树节点生成可序列化的规则对象供运行时调用代码示例AST节点定义Gotype ConditionNode struct { Operator string // 操作符AND/OR Left *ConditionNode json:,omitempty Right *ConditionNode json:,omitempty Fact string json:fact,omitempty // 如login_days Comparator string json:cmp,omitempty // 如 Value interface{} json:val,omitempty // 值 }该结构支持递归遍历每个节点代表一个逻辑或原子条件。运行时通过深度优先遍历评估路径结果结合缓存机制提升重复计算效率。性能优化策略阶段处理动作预编译DSL → AST 缓存加载按活动ID索引加载规则集执行并行评估分支 短路求值2.2 多平台接口适配层的抽象建模与动态调用在构建跨平台系统时多平台接口适配层的核心在于统一不同平台的异构接口。通过定义抽象接口模型可将各平台的具体实现进行封装。接口抽象设计采用面向接口编程思想定义统一的服务契约type PlatformClient interface { Invoke(method string, params map[string]interface{}) (interface{}, error) HealthCheck() bool }该接口屏蔽底层差异所有平台客户端需实现此契约确保上层调用一致性。动态调用机制通过注册中心动态加载对应平台适配器结合配置元数据实现路由分发解析请求目标平台标识从适配器池中获取对应实例执行参数映射与协议转换[图示请求经由抽象层路由至具体平台适配器]2.3 用户画像驱动的报名策略生成机制实战应用用户画像标签体系构建基于用户行为日志与静态属性构建多维度标签体系涵盖基础属性、学习偏好、互动频率等维度。通过Flink实时计算引擎完成动态标签更新保障画像时效性。策略规则引擎配置采用Drools规则引擎实现条件匹配根据用户画像输出差异化报名引导策略。典型规则示例如下rule 高意向用户强引导 when $user: User( score 80, lastVisitDays 3 ) then System.out.println(触发弹窗限时优惠报名通道); setStrategy($user, PROMPT_POPUP); end该规则表示当用户兴趣评分高于80且近3日内活跃触发高转化弹窗策略提升转化率。策略执行效果对比用户分群曝光量点击率转化率高意向群体12,43028.7%15.2%普通群体45,2109.3%3.1%2.4 自动化表单填充的语义理解与字段映射技术自动化表单填充依赖于对字段语义的精准理解与智能映射。系统需识别页面输入框的实际含义如“姓名”、“邮箱”等并将其与本地数据模型对齐。语义解析流程通过自然语言处理技术分析标签文本、占位符及邻近上下文提取字段意图。例如结合“手机号”、“mobile”等关键词判断输入类型。字段映射策略采用规则匹配与机器学习融合方式实现高精度映射。常见字段对应关系如下页面字段文本语义类型数据源字段email, 邮箱emailuser.profile.emailtel, 手机号phoneuser.contact.mobile// 示例基于语义标签填充表单 function autofillForm(fields) { fields.forEach(field { const semanticType inferSemanticType(field.label, field.placeholder); const value dataMapping[semanticType]; // 查找映射值 if (value) field.value value; }); }该函数遍历所有输入字段推断其语义类型后从数据模型中提取对应值进行填充实现智能化自动填表。2.5 实时反作弊检测模块在高频报名中的部署优化在高频报名场景下反作弊系统面临高并发与低延迟的双重挑战。为提升检测效率采用轻量级规则引擎与流式计算结合的架构。数据同步机制通过Kafka实现用户行为日志的实时采集与分发确保反作弊模块能及时获取注册流量数据。弹性部署策略使用Kubernetes动态扩缩容根据QPS自动调整反作弊服务实例数。关键配置如下apiVersion: apps/v1 kind: Deployment metadata: name: anti-fraud-service spec: replicas: 3 strategy: rollingUpdate: maxSurge: 1 maxUnavailable: 0该配置保障升级期间服务不中断maxUnavailable: 0确保最小处理能力始终在线。响应延迟对比部署模式平均延迟(ms)误判率单体架构856.2%优化后集群232.1%第三章核心模块六至七的深度整合与效能提升3.1 分布式任务调度系统的架构设计与性能压测核心架构设计分布式任务调度系统采用主从架构由中心调度器Master和多个执行节点Worker组成。Master 负责任务分发与状态管理Worker 接收并执行任务通过心跳机制维持连接。通信协议与数据结构系统使用 gRPC 进行节点间通信定义如下服务接口service TaskScheduler { rpc ScheduleTask(TaskRequest) returns (TaskResponse); rpc ReportStatus(StatusReport) returns (Ack); } message TaskRequest { string task_id 1; string payload 2; // 任务数据 int64 timeout_ms 3; // 超时时间 }该协议支持高效序列化降低网络开销提升调度响应速度。性能压测方案使用 JMeter 模拟高并发任务提交测试系统在不同负载下的吞吐量与延迟表现并发数QPS平均延迟(ms)失败率100850120%5003200450.2%结果表明系统具备良好的横向扩展能力与稳定性。3.2 基于反馈闭环的模型自进化机制线上实测分析在实际生产环境中模型自进化能力依赖于高效的反馈闭环机制。系统通过实时采集用户交互数据自动触发模型微调流程。反馈数据采集与处理采集到的日志经清洗后进入训练队列关键字段包括预测结果、用户行为反馈及上下文特征{ prediction_id: pred_123, user_action: rejection, // 接受/拒绝 features: [0.23, 1.45, ...], timestamp: 2025-04-05T10:00:00Z }该结构支持快速构建监督信号用于后续增量训练。性能对比分析经过两周A/B测试启用自进化机制的实验组表现显著提升指标基线模型自进化模型准确率86.2%91.7%响应延迟142ms145ms微小延迟增加换取了可观的精度增益验证了闭环机制的有效性与工程可行性。3.3 全链路监控与异常熔断机制的实际运行效果实时监控数据采集系统通过埋点上报与日志聚合实现对服务调用链的全路径追踪。关键指标如响应延迟、错误率、QPS 被实时推送至监控中心。熔断策略触发效果当某下游服务错误率超过阈值时熔断器自动切换至开启状态阻止后续请求避免雪崩。以下是核心配置示例// 熔断器配置 circuitBreaker : gobreaker.Settings{ Name: UserService, Timeout: 5 * time.Second, // 熔断持续时间 ReadyToTrip: func(counts gobreaker.Counts) bool { return counts.ConsecutiveFailures 5 // 连续5次失败触发熔断 }, }该配置在生产环境中有效降低级联故障发生率平均恢复时间缩短至8秒内。指标熔断前熔断后平均响应时间(ms)125086服务可用性89.2%99.8%第四章系统级协同与工程化落地关键路径4.1 模块间通信协议设计与低延迟数据交换实践在分布式系统中模块间高效通信是保障性能的核心。为实现低延迟数据交换需设计轻量、可扩展的通信协议。协议选型与结构设计采用基于二进制的 Protocol Buffers 序列化格式结合 gRPC 实现多语言兼容的高效 RPC 通信。相比 JSON其序列化体积减少 60% 以上。message DataPacket { int64 timestamp 1; bytes payload 2; string source_id 3; }该结构定义了通用数据包支持快速解析与校验payload字段用于承载业务数据降低传输开销。数据同步机制通过双通道策略提升响应速度控制流使用同步调用数据流采用异步批量推送。以下为连接配置示例参数值说明max_concurrent_streams100限制并发流数量keepalive_time30s维持长连接心跳此配置有效减少连接重建开销确保亚毫秒级端到端延迟。4.2 配置热更新与灰度发布体系的工程实现配置热更新机制设计为实现服务无需重启即可动态调整行为采用基于事件监听的配置中心架构。通过监听配置变更事件触发本地缓存刷新与组件重载。// 监听Nacos配置变更 configClient.ListenConfig(vo.ConfigParam{ DataId: service-a.yaml, Group: DEFAULT_GROUP, OnChange: func(namespace, group, dataId, data string) { log.Printf(配置已更新: %s, dataId) ReloadConfiguration([]byte(data)) // 重新加载配置 }, })上述代码注册回调函数当配置发生变更时自动触发ReloadConfiguration方法完成运行时参数热更新。灰度发布策略实施通过标签路由实现流量分级控制支持按用户标识、IP段等维度将请求导向特定版本实例。策略类型匹配条件目标版本用户ID前缀uid^gray-v2.1IP哈希取模ip % 100 10v2.14.3 敏感信息加密存储与权限隔离的安全实践在现代应用架构中敏感数据如用户凭证、API密钥和支付信息必须通过加密手段保障静态存储安全。推荐使用AES-256等强加密算法并结合密钥管理系统KMS实现密钥轮换与访问审计。加密存储实现示例// 使用AES-GCM模式加密配置数据 func encryptData(plaintext, key []byte) (ciphertext, nonce []byte, err error) { block, err : aes.NewCipher(key) if err ! nil { return nil, nil, err } gcm, err : cipher.NewGCM(block) if err ! nil { return nil, nil, err } nonce make([]byte, gcm.NonceSize()) if _, err io.ReadFull(rand.Reader, nonce); err ! nil { return nil, nil, err } ciphertext gcm.Seal(nil, nonce, plaintext, nil) return ciphertext, nonce, nil }上述代码采用AES-GCM模式提供机密性与完整性保护。参数key应由KMS托管避免硬编码nonce需唯一以防止重放攻击。权限隔离策略基于角色的访问控制RBAC限制数据库读写权限微服务间通信启用mTLS双向认证敏感操作记录完整审计日志4.4 日志追踪体系与可观测性增强方案落地在微服务架构下分布式系统的调用链路日益复杂传统日志排查方式已难以满足故障定位需求。为此构建统一的日志追踪体系成为提升系统可观测性的关键。核心组件集成通过引入 OpenTelemetry SDK 实现跨服务 trace 透传结合 Jaeger 作为后端分析引擎完整记录请求路径。所有服务统一使用结构化日志输出{ timestamp: 2023-11-05T10:23:45Z, trace_id: a3d9f8b2c7e1..., span_id: b5c8d9e0f1a2..., level: INFO, message: order processed, service: order-service }该格式确保日志可被集中采集并关联至具体调用链trace_id 和 span_id 支持全链路回溯。可观测性增强策略建立日志、指标、追踪三位一体监控模型通过 Fluent Bit 实现日志采集轻量化部署在网关层注入全局 Request-ID贯穿整个调用生命周期最终实现从异常告警到根因定位的分钟级响应能力显著提升系统运维效率。第五章从自动化到智能化——电商运营的新范式智能推荐系统的实战部署现代电商平台已不再满足于基于规则的自动化脚本转而采用机器学习驱动的智能决策系统。以用户个性化推荐为例通过协同过滤与深度学习结合的方式可动态调整商品展示优先级。# 基于用户行为的实时推荐模型片段 def generate_recommendations(user_id, recent_clicks): user_vector embedding_model.encode(recent_clicks) similarities cosine_similarity(user_vector, product_vectors) top_indices np.argsort(similarities)[-10:][::-1] return [product_catalog[i] for i in top_indices] # 返回最相关商品自动化营销向智能决策演进传统定时邮件推送正被AI驱动的触达策略取代。系统根据用户生命周期阶段、历史转化路径和实时活跃度自动选择最佳沟通渠道与内容模板。用户A浏览未下单 → 触发2小时后个性化优惠弹窗用户B加入购物车未支付 → 智能预测最佳催付时间平均延迟38分钟用户C高频购买母婴品 → 动态生成组合套餐并推送订阅服务智能库存与需求预测联动利用LSTM网络对历史销售、季节趋势、促销活动进行多维建模实现SKU级精准预测。某头部母婴电商应用该方案后缺货率下降42%滞销库存减少37%。指标传统方法智能预测系统预测准确率68%89%补货响应时间72小时24小时